While Montpelier station does not boast a ticket office, you can easily buy and collect tickets from the available ticket machines. If you require additional support, the station features accessible machines and an induction loop to ensure a seamless experience for everyone. Although there are no waiting rooms or 1st class lounges, there is some comfortable seating to ease your wait.
For those thinking about security, rest assured, the station is equipped with CCTV. However, note that facilities like a refreshment area, ATMs, or baby-changing stations are not available, so plan accordingly. If cycling is your preferred mode of transport to and from the station, it offers some bicycle racks for storage, although they aren't sheltered.
Montpelier offers step-free access across the station, supporting passengers with mobility challenges. While staff help is not explicitly available, assistance for those who need it can be requested up to 2 hours before their journey begins with the Passenger Assist service. Seven Kings station is equipped with a range of facilities to make your journey as smooth and comfortable as possible. The ticket office is open from the early hours until late in the evenings on weekdays, and slightly reduced hours over the weekend. For added convenience, there are also ticket machines that allow you to collect tickets bought online, and these are accessible to all passengers.
Step-free access throughout the station ensures an easy transit for passengers with disabilities, with accessible seating available on platforms. While there’s no dedicated parking or waiting rooms, the station does provide seating areas with shelters on platforms 3 and 4. Refreshment facilities include a coffee kiosk at platform 3 and a snacks shop in the ticket hall, ensuring you're never short of a quick bite or drink.
For those looking at onward travel options from Seven Kings, the station is well-served by local London buses operating from outside, making the transition to city exploration seamless. In case of any rail disruptions, dedicated rail replacement buses facilitate continuance of your journey from High Road at bus stops T and M. Additionally, the station offers seamless travel for air passengers via the Elizabeth Line to Heathrow airport, ensuring comfort and convenience.
